Saint Vincent and the Grenadines reiterated, Tuesday in New York, its support for Morocco’s Autonomy plan, “the only solution” to definitively settle the regional dispute over the Moroccan Sahara.
“We recognize the Autonomy Initiative presented by the Kingdom of Morocco as a unique solution” to this artificial conflict, stressed Lasana Andrews, Counselor at the Permanent Mission of Saint Vincent and the Grenadines to the United Nations.
Speaking before members of the 4th Committee of the UN General Assembly, the speaker called on all parties concerned to engage in the UN political process guided by dialogue, compromise, and respect for international law with a view to achieving a peaceful resolution of this regional dispute.
The diplomat also welcomed the efforts of the UN Secretary-General and his Personal Envoy to facilitate the resumption of the political process.
